Jacob's Ladder and Copperleaf Physical Information

Jacob's Ladder and Copperleaf physical information is very important for comparison. Jacob's Ladder height is 20.30 cm and width 27.90 cm whereas Copperleaf height is 240.00 cm and width 180.00 cm. The color specification of Jacob's Ladder and Copperleaf are as follows:

  • Jacob's Ladder flower color: Blue and Lavender

  • Jacob's Ladder leaf color: Green and Purple

  • Copperleaf flower color: Red, Green and Copper

  • Copperleaf leaf color: White, Yellow, Green, Purple, Orange, Chartreuse, Dark Green, Pink, Rose, Burgundy, Copper and Bronze
